BT pension scheme's new chief executive confirmed

The £39bn BT Pension Scheme, the UK's largest, confirmed yesterday it has hired Eileen Haughey of the ICI Pension Fund to be its new chief executive, as Financial News first reported last week. Haughey has led the ICI fund's in-house office for about 18 months. She will join the BT fund in the summer, reporting to Paul Spencer, chairman of the scheme's trustees. Haughey said she considered herself "privileged" to lead "a high calibre team with strong plans for the future."
